However, most approaches are using metamodels in a very pragmatic way and important conceptual questions are left open. In this paper, an object-oriented metamodeling methodology based on a formal metalanguage is introduced. The methodology allows for the description of all relevant properties of a metamodel, i.e. abstract syntax, static and dynamic semantics. Different kinds of instantiation relations are identified and a dichotomy for the classification of metaentities in intensional and extensional entities is developed.
